'Double trouble' in NY
published: Saturday | September 13, 2008


Olsen twins - Contributed

Mary-Kate and Ashley Olsen have been labelled "disruptive, intrusive and totally disrespectful" by their New York neighbours.

The twins - who shot to fame when they starred on US TV show Full House in 1987 - have been angering residents who live near their flat in the West Village with their constant partying.

One resident said: "Mary-Kate and Ashley are two spoiled brats who change the character of the neighbourhood."

Another added: "It is a peaceful, quiet street. Plenty of other celebrities around this block - Sarah Jessica Parker, Liv Tyler, Gisele Bundchen and Julianne Moore - are good neighbours and blend in with the neighbourhood - but these two are invaders."

The 22-year-old siblings have also caused chaos with the heavy security they have employed around the neighbourhood.

A neighbour on West 13th Street, who said there are two giant GMC Denali SUVs parked outside the twins' home every night, said: "You would think there was a government operation going on with the amount of security they have.

"The good news is that it's only a rental, and we all hope it's not a long-standing one."

A representative for the twins denied the claims, telling the New York Post newspaper: "If there were significant issues, you would think that the neighbours would address Ashley or Mary-Kate directly, rather than calling the media."
